BRIEFING: Retirement of the Corvane Ledger Line

For leadership review. Finance team note: Corvane Ledger sales fell 38% year over year. Support costs now exceed margin. Proposal: end new sales in Q2, honour maintenance contracts through year-end, migrate remaining accounts to the Ashfell platform. Write-down of residual inventory estimated at 220k. Headcount reallocated, no redundancies. Decision required at Friday's review. The retirement schedule assumes board sign-off on the successor roadmap.

confidential, tagag-kahof: Rusathox Partners plans to lower the Gorox list price by 63 percent in December.

**Runbook: Parcel webhook stalled deliveries**

If Pakketron webhook queue depth exceeds 500, check the carrier adapter health endpoint first. Restart the dispatcher pod only if lag persists past 10 minutes. Never replay events older than 24h without approval. Log the incident in the support channel and attach the current build identifier, shown below.

pipeline stamp: htk31_f769b577b3028a4e9958e5bb8d1259a

# Stormrelay Fan-Out: Limits and Quotas

The Stormrelay service fans out weather alerts to regional subscriber queues. To keep downstream gateways from saturating during multi-county alerts, fan-out is throttled per shard and batched per region. Exceeding these limits drops to a degraded slow-path, not an error. Do not raise them without load-testing the Kestrelwick gateway tier first. Current quota constants are as follows.

tuning constants:
QUOTAS = {
    "druwyn": 5,
    "holix": 5,
    "zorath": 5,
    "holwyn": 10,
}

Subject: Ownership change — digest scheduling

As of next sprint, responsibility for the batch email digest scheduler in Lanternpost moves out of the platform group. This covers the cron definitions, retry policy, and the quiet-hours logic for regional sends. Please route all release questions, cutoff approvals, and rollback decisions for digest scheduling to the new owner going forward, named below.

signatory, fafog-bagef: Jorwyn Juleth Pelius